Tony Hong, also known as Hong Seok-cheon, sits down on What A Life! to reflect on the decision that changed everything.
After coming out as one of South Korea’s first openly LGBTQ mainstream celebrities, he lost his career almost overnight. But instead of stepping away, he chose to rebuild his life from the beginning.
In this conversation, Tony opens up about the pressure of being the only son in a traditional family, starting over after public backlash, and the kindness that helped him remain in the industry.
He also shares how he turned pain into purpose, why he hopes kindness will become his legacy, and how a new generation of young LGBTQ Koreans gives him hope for the future.
